网络协议是现代通信技术的重要基石,支撑着我们日常生活中各种在线活动。从网络浏览到视频通话,协议在不同的使用场景中发挥着各自的作用。理解网络协议的背景与功能,能够帮助我们更好地利用网络资源,提高网络安全性和效率。网络协议不仅仅是一串复杂的技术术语,它们实际上是网络设备之间进行有效沟通的语言。通过进一步探讨这些协议,我们可以更深入地了解它们对互联网发展的推动作用以及在信息传输中的关键意义。

网络协议的定义是它们为计算机网络通信提供一套标准化的规则和约定。这些规则确保了不同设备之间的数据能够无障碍地传输。以互联网协议(IP)为例,它负责在网络中标识设备并确保数据包能够找到正确的目的地。传输控制协议(TCP)则负责在数据传输过程中进行流量控制和错误检测,保障数据的完整性与顺畅性。
在众多网络协议中,超文本传输协议(HTTP)无疑是最为广为人知的,它是实现网页浏览的基础。随着网络技术的发展,HTTPS应运而生,它在HTTP的基础上增加了加密层,以提供更高的安全性。这对于保护用户隐私及敏感信息尤为重要,尤其是在进行在线交易时。简单邮件传输协议(SMTP)和邮局协议(POP)则是邮件通信的标准化协议,它们确保了电子邮件的高效传送和接收。
网络协议的多样性也体现在适应性上,根据不同的应用场景和需求,开发者可以选择合适的协议来优化网络性能。例如,实时通信中使用的用户数据报协议(UDP)允许数据包的不完整传输,以降低延迟,确保实时性,而不是过于追求数据的完整性。这使得视频会议和在线游戏等应用能够获得更好的用户体验。
网络协议不仅是信息技术发展的基础,更是保障网络安全与高效连接的必要工具。从数据传输的可靠性到信息安全的保护,深入了解网络协议的作用和意义,将为网络使用者打开新机会,提升网络应用的体验。随着科技的不断进步,网络协议也在持续演化,对未来的互联网发展将继续产生深远的影响。
